Caspase-3 inhibitor (Z-DEVD-FMK) is a cell-permeable, potent, and irreversible inhibitor of caspase-3, caspase-6, caspase-7, caspase-8 and caspase-10. Caspase inhibitors play an important role in investigating biological processes. The caspase family of proteins function as key components of the apoptotic machinery and act to destroy specific target proteins which are critical to cellular longevity. Following use of the inhibitor, standard apoptosis assays can then be used to examine treated cells for evidence of apoptosis.For the fluorometric determination of caspase-3 activity, the following caspase apoptosis detection kit is available from Santa Cruz: Caspase-3 Kit (sc-4263 AK).

What is the solubility of this compound?

Asked by: two2igm05
Thank you for your question. The solubility of Caspase-3 Inhibitor, sc-3075, is DMSO/DMF (>=20 mM).
